Environmental Monitoring & Measurement:
- Sustainability Cloud/Workiva for ESG data management and reporting
- Plan A/Persefoni for carbon footprint calculation and emissions tracking
- Enablon/Cority for environmental management and compliance tracking
- EcoVadis/CDP for sustainability assessment and benchmarking
Energy & Resource Management:
- EnergyCAP/Schneider Electric for energy monitoring and optimization
- WaterSmart/Banyan Water for water usage tracking and conservation
- Waste Management/Rubicon for waste tracking and circular economy solutions
- Green Building/ENERGY STAR for facility efficiency and certification management
Supply Chain & Procurement:
- EcoVadis/Sedex for supplier sustainability assessment
- Supply Shift/IntegrityNext for supply chain transparency and risk management
- Sourcemap/OpenSC for supply chain traceability and impact tracking
- B2B marketplace/Tred for sustainable product sourcing and procurement
Reporting & Communication:
- Tableau/Power BI for sustainability dashboard and visualization
- GRI/SASB Standards for sustainability reporting frameworks
- Bloomberg ESG/MSCI for ESG rating and investor communication
- Salesforce Sustainability/SAP for integrated business and sustainability management
